URGENT UPDATE: A shocking incident unfolded during a wedding celebration in Glendale, California as a wedding crasher was caught on camera stealing an estimated $10,000 in gifts meant for the newlyweds. The brazen theft occurred on Saturday, October 21, 2023, at the Renaissance Banquet Hall, turning a joyful occasion into a heartbreaking moment for George and Nadeen Farahat.
Security footage reveals the thief blending seamlessly into the crowd while guests danced, only to swipe the couple’s wedding gift box without raising suspicion. This distressing turn of events has left the couple and their loved ones reeling, as they had hoped to start their new life together with love and support, not devastation.
In response to this theft, a GoFundMe page was launched by friend Jerry Haddad, aimed at raising funds to replace what was stolen. “Instead of beginning this chapter with joy and security, they were left heartbroken,” the page states, calling on the community to come together.
As of now, authorities have not confirmed if they have identified the suspect or made any arrests in connection with this ongoing investigation. The Glendale Police Department is actively looking into the incident, urging anyone with information to come forward.
